Evitando mensagem de "Nao foi possivel conectar !"

17:09 1
BOm,depois de ver tantos topicos identicos sobre "Unable to conect !" "Nao e possivel conectar oO" "Nao conectaaa", resolvi criar um
tutorial para cada coisa que pode ser checada pós criaçao de server ^^
Vamos la !

===> O que pode estar dando errado ?
*IP do seu Game.exe incorreto.
*Ptreg do seu cliente mal configurado.
*Entradas de Registro nao foram executadas.
*ldata do seu cliente estar mal configurada.
*Portas do Game.exe e do Server.exe estao diferentes.
*Hotuk mal configurado.
*Firewall do windows esta bloqueando as portas do Game.exe e do Server.exe.
*ODBC mal configurado.
*SQL.dll e SQL.reg nao configuradas.


OBS: Se voce usa ODBC delete a SQL.dll, e se voce usa SQL.dll nao crie ODBC

===> Mudando o ip do Game.exe.

Abra seu game.exe no Hex editor e procure por "Saindo" ou "Quitting" (vai depender do game.exe), e um pouco
abaixo vai aparecer o ip do seu game como mostra na imagem:

No meu caso ele esta 127.0.0.1 (ip local) mais se voce quiser trocar e so ir no site www.meuip.com.br
e digitar encima do que esta la.

Bom, agora procure por <3hawk e um pouco acima está mais um ip, mude-o para seu ip.

OBS: Se sobrar numeros grudados no seu ip nao colque ... (pontinhos) no lugar, isso pode dar problemas !

Faça como na imagen :


Onde esta marcado em vermelho no meu caso é aonde sobrou o resto de numeros do antigo ip, para removelo preencha com 00

Salve e feche
Pronto seu game.exe esta configurado !

===>Configurando Ptreg.

Crie um arquivo de texto e cole isso dentro:
Código: [Selecionar]

"WindowMode" "0"
"Graphic" "1"
"ColorBPP" "16"
"Network" "0"
"CameraInvert" "false"
"MotionBlur" "false"
"CameraSight" "OFF"
"ScreenSize" "0"
"Sound" "On"
"Server1" "SEUIP"
"Server2" "SEUIP"
"Server3" "SEUIP"

Configure seu ip como pedido  e salve como Ptreg.rgx e coloque na pasta do seu cliente.

===> Entradas de Registro.

Crie um arquivo de texto com qualquer nome e cole isso dentro:
Código: [Selecionar]
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Triglow Pictures\PristonTale]
"Version"="SuaVersao"
"Graphic"="0"
"Network"="1"
"ScreenSize"="0"
"ColorBPP"="32"
"MotionBlur"="false"
"CameraSight"="ON"
"Sound"="on"
"CameraInvert"="false"
"MicOption"="OFF"
"Server1"="SEUIP"
"Server2"="SEUIP"
"Server3"="SEUIP"
"ServerName"="NomeDoSeuSERVER"
"TestVersion"="SuaVersao"
"FirstFlg"="1"
"WINDOWMode"="1"
Configure como pedido acima e
salve como Execute-me.reg

De dois clikes no arquivo criado e clique em SIm e OK !

==> COnfigurando ldata.

Va na pasta "image" do seu pt e abra como bloco de notas a imagen "ldata.bmp" e configure o seu ip,
ela e muito parecida com o ptreg entao nem vou citar o que tem dentro dela ^^.

==> Alterando Portas do seu Game.exe e do Server.exe.

Segue o Link: http://www.mundopriston.com/forum/index.php?topic=77.0

==> Configurando o Hotuk com seu ip.

Abra o hotuk que esta na pasta do seu server e modifike os ips que estao la para o ip desejado.
Para nao precisar ficar modifikando um por um, copie o ip que esta la e aperta ctrl + H e coloque ele na caixa "localizar"
e coloque o ip que voce quer na caixa "Subistituir" e pronto ^^ ! 
Salve e feche.

==>Liberando as portas no Firewall

Va em iniciar>painel de controle>firewall Do windows, clique em Exceçoes e adicionar porta.
Coloque o nome (qualquer um) e a porta que voce colocou no Game.exe e no Server.exe
De ok e pronto !

==> Configurando ODBC

Segue o link do tuto: http://www.mundopriston.com/forum/index.php?topic=78.0

==> Configurando SQL.DLL

Faça o download da Sql.dll aqui: http://www.megaupload.com/?d=URBYZSZD
Abra ela no hex editor aperte ctrl+h digite 123456 que e a senha do sa padrao e coloque a sua
para subistituir.

OBS: Se a sua senha tiver - ou + que 6 caracteres fassa isso manualmente com o ctrl+f se nao voce pode corromper a dll.

Feito isso, aperta ctrl+F e procure por "Dimas" e coloque o seu endereço sql, para ver o 
seu endereço sql va em iniciar>botao esquerdo no meu computador>Propriedades>nome do computador>alterar.
Agora vamos mudar o iP, aperte ctrl+f e escreva 127.0.0.1 que e o ip local, coloque o seu ip em todos os lugares que tiver esse ip.
Feito isso salve e e feche.

==>COnfigurando SQl.reg

Abra a sql.reg no bloco de notas aperte CTRL+h e digite 123456 na caixa localizar  e digite sua senha Sa na caixa subistituir, de ok e subistitua tudo.
Feito isso repita o processo mais dessa vez com o seu endereço Sql, escreva PT\SQLEXPRESS no campo localizar e coloque o seu endereço no campo subistituir e subistitua tudo.
Agora tem uma linha chamada "ServerName" coloque o nome do seu pt como no exemplo:

"ServerName"="BobocasPT"

Salve e feche,
Depois execute e clique em Sim e OK!

==>Se os Problemas persistirem..

*Seu Game.exe ou Server exe podem estar com defeito, troque-os!
*Sua server files esta com problema, troque-a!
*Seu server pode estar mal criado, delete tudo e faça dnovo.



Espero ter ajudado ^^

1 Comments for "Evitando mensagem de "Nao foi possivel conectar !""